## Local Setup: Config Hot-Reload

Brookside watches `conf.d/` and applies changes without restarts; edits take effect within five seconds. Invalid files are rejected and logged, keeping the last good config active. Reload events are audited in the settings database, which you should verify is reachable first. Connect with the string below.

primary connection of yagep-kahip = redis://giliel_svc:zYiKsLL2PLpfPL@db-348f.xolmarsys.corp:5432/fenwyn

Subject: Gateway rate-limit handover

Hi Brennic,

Welcome aboard! Quick notes on the Ostrel gateway: per-client limits live in the `rl_policies` table, refreshed every 60 seconds by the limiter daemon. Don't edit limits live without pinging ops first. To poke around the policy tables yourself, use the connection string below.

database URL for bagap-yahap: mysql://druax_svc:s0i8rHw@db-fdc1.orvexworks.local:5432/druius

The Ordertrace support console reads from the `orders` table in Bramblehook's primary database, where soft-deleted rows are marked with a `deleted_at` timestamp rather than removed. To view or restore these rows, the console must authenticate to the internal Rowkeeper service, which enforces per-team visibility rules. Support staff do not need individual accounts; the shared service credential below grants read and restore access but never hard deletes. Rotation happens quarterly. Authenticate by sending this key with each request:

API key for yahig-tadup: kto7_ubizbYm

## Encoding Detection for Uploaded Text Files

Welcome to the Textloom ingestion team. When users upload text files, the Charmwick detector samples the first 64 KB and scores candidate encodings before falling back to UTF-8 with replacement characters. Never trust the declared charset header; uploads from the legacy Bramleigh portal routinely lie. If detection confidence drops below 0.7, the file is quarantined and requires manual review. To unlock the quarantine vault, use the recovery passphrase below.

vault phrase of tajef-tafog = istox-sorax-zorox-casok-holox-kelix-weneth-drueth-casion